Art and Design PGCE peer-led workshops

Every student on our (Secondary) Art and Design PGCE brings their own art subject expertise, experience and practice to the course and we develop this rich vein by sharing ideas and techniques through peer-led workshops. These sessions are planned and taught by our students, who then receive feedback from course leaders to help develop their subject knowledge and planning skills.

Workshops have included techniques such as:

  • expressive drawing
  • collaborative sculpture
  • screen printing
  • textile and simple weaving techniques, batik
  • plaster casting
  • ceramics
  • wet room photography

The School of Education has excellent art studios, facilities and specialist equipment. Trainee teachers also have access to over 30,000 specialist teaching resources in our curriculum centre. Students have highlighted these as key strengths of the course.
